A top-rated horror flick that fans claim leaves 'a lasting scare' is now streaming for free - perfectly timed for Halloween season. Released in 2012, Sinister can now be viewed on streaming service Tubi. The film features four-time Oscar nominee Ethan Hawke as troubled crime writer Ellison Oswalt.
Eager to write a best seller, Ellison secretly moves his family into a house where the brutal murders he is investigating took place. However, when he discovers an unsettling video that exposes paranormal activity within the home, the writer must confront the supernatural threat, reports the Mirror.
The mystery thriller was helmed by Scott Derrickson, who horror enthusiasts will recognise for directing The Black Phone films. Derrickson additionally acted as screenwriter, working with C. Robert Cargill.
Hawke appears opposite Juliet Rylance, portraying his screen spouse Tracy. The pair are accompanied by Michael Hall D'Addario and Clare Foley. The ensemble also includes The Good Wife performer Fred Thompson and It: Chapter Two star James Ransone.
Sinister garnered middling critiques following its debut. It secured a 64 per cent Rotten Tomatoes rating, with the reviewers' summary stating: "Its plot hinges on typically implausible horror-movie behaviour and recycles countless genre clichés, but Sinister delivers a surprising number of fresh, diabolical twists."
